IAEA probes S.Korean scientists action on uranium separation

The International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) is probing whether several South Korean scientists have conducted an experiment on separating uranium four years ago, reported the South Korean Yonhap News Agency on Thursday.

Yonhap quoted sources at the South Korean Science and Technology Ministry as saying that the IAEA sent investigators to South Korea on Aug. 29 after receiving South Korean government's report that several South Korean scientists have conducted such experiment from January to February in 2000.
